Most companies do not fail with AI because the model is bad.
They fail because the agent is sitting on top of fragmented systems, duplicated records, stale data, missing attributes, spreadsheet fixes, and business rules nobody encoded.
bluefabric fixes the foundation. We connect the systems where supply chain data lives, enrich what is incomplete, map it into a common supply chain model, and expose it through MCP so any agent can reason, calculate, and act safely.

We kept seeing the same problem: companies wanted AI agents, but the agents had no reliable supply chain context. The data was scattered across WMS, ERP, TMS, spreadsheets, portals, and legacy tools. Even when the model was good, it was forced to guess from messy inputs.
bluefabric was built to solve that foundation problem. It gives agents the data layer they actually need: clean objects, supply chain relationships, trusted calculations, and governed actions. Not another chatbot. Not another dashboard. The operational brain behind useful AI.
